Cytosolic GR plays crucial roles in: Protecting cellular proteins from oxidative damage and maintaining their proper folding Supporting phase II detoxification pathways that require reduced glutathione as a cofactor Preserving the integrity of cellular membranes by preventing lipid peroxidation Modulating cell signaling pathways sensitive to redox status Defending against xenobiotic compounds that enter the cytoplasm The activity of cytosolic GR is tightly regulated and can be induced under conditions of oxidative stress, providing an adaptive response mechanism to increased free radical production
